Output 5c3751f9025b94a3804ea13bf252b70e68ef932ba7c6b8350593475984f2fb7b:0

value
951905614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d9950da5bcab8956cf763aad2a5607f1a28f210 OP_EQUAL
address
35r7zkGjoShuFndJUr9y8QW8JQxZQZ1MaN
transaction
5c3751f9025b94a3804ea13bf252b70e68ef932ba7c6b8350593475984f2fb7b
spent
true